Staff Software Engineer, Observability & Profiling at Anthropic

on-site · full-time · Visa sponsorship

Apply for this role at Anthropic

Responsibilities:
- Design and build scalable telemetry ingest and storage pipelines for metrics, logs, traces, and error data across multi-cluster infrastructure.
- Build low-overhead observability solutions (continuous profiling, eBPF tracing, network visibility) that surface root causes from kernel/accelerator to application.
- Own and evolve core observability platforms, driving migrations, cost/reliability improvements, and platform-wide instrumentation.
- Create instrumentation libraries, SDKs, and auto-instrumentation (including eBPF) to emit high-quality telemetry without heavy code changes.
- Implement cross-signal correlation and unified query interfaces to reduce mean time to detection and resolution.
- Partner with Research, Inference, Product, and Infrastructure teams to tailor observability for GPU/TPU/Trainium workloads and fleet efficiency.

Requirements:
- Hands-on experience building and operating large-scale observability or monitoring infrastructure.
- Deep familiarity with telemetry signals end-to-end: instrumentation, ingest, storage, query, and analysis (metrics, logs, traces, profiles).
- Experience with high-throughput telemetry pipelines, sampling strategies, and trade-offs for storage and query cost vs. fidelity.
- Practical knowledge of eBPF, kernel-level debugging, continuous profiling, and accelerator telemetry is highly desirable.
- Strong system-design and performance-engineering skills, plus experience collaborating across research and infrastructure teams.
- Ability to deliver production-grade tooling that scales across large multi-cluster deployments and reduces operational toil.
